Is A Lightweight Wheelchair Right For You?

Having a quality lightweight wheelchair can improve an individual’s life dramatically. Durability, ease-of-use, and portability are some of the most important factors to consider when buying one. Is a lightweight wheelchair right for you? Lightweight wheelchairs have unique advantages that their heavier counterparts do not. We know the decision can be difficult – that’s why we’re going to take a closer look at the benefits and drawbacks of this kind of wheelchair.

Durable Materials

Probably the first thing that comes to mind when you think of a lightweight wheelchair is a lack of durability. This kind of wheelchair used to be somewhat fragile and easy to break.

Today, they are made out of premium materials such as aircraft-grade aluminum and can weight as little as thirty-three pounds. The low weight makes it easy to move and pick up the chair whenever needed. Innovation has allowed for an array of options in the last few decades when it comes to quality wheelchairs.

Storing and Portability

Many lighter wheelchairs are easy to store because they can usually be folded with ease. Because they are lighter, they are also more portable and can be quickly loaded and unloaded from vehicles. This is a more important aspect than you might think.

Wheelchairs that are easily transported allow users to visit more places without difficulty. A heavy chair might not be able to travel to locations lighter ones can traverse, in other words. Lightweight chairs are truly the definition of easy storage and portability.

Terrain Navigation

It is no secret that using a wheelchair takes a decent amount of upper body strength. Why make the process harder than it needs to be? A quality lightweight wheelchair should be able to handle even rough terrain.

Make sure that you opt for a chair that is designed to work well on the kinds of surfaces you’re likely to encounter. Some excel in places like parks, for example, while others are intended to be used mainly indoors.

Who is Best Suited for Lightweight Wheelchairs?

Lightweight wheelchairs are best suited for individuals who weigh 250 pounds or less. They’re a great fit for people who want to be as active as possible or spend a lot of time outside.

It is a good idea to consider your type of lifestyle before choosing the kind of wheelchair you purchase. Lightweight wheelchairs have many advantages, but there are better options if you’re hoping for superior support on rough terrain.
